Barry M. Goldwater Scholarship Program

Program Information

Popular name

Barry Goldwater Scholarship Foundation

Program Number

85.200

Program objective

To honor former Senator Barry Goldwater through the operation of an education scholarship program, financed by a permanent trust fund endowment, designed to encourage outstanding students to pursue research careers in mathematics, the natural sciences, and engineering.
